WebDefinition of Triple Bottom Line. The “Triple Bottom Line” (TBL) concept was first put forward by John Elkington in 1994. The key idea behind the Triple Bottom Line concept is – “Doing Well by Doing Good”, underlining the social role of the corporate organization and how it can do better by focusing on its customers but also by ... WebEssentially, the triple bottom line is an accounting framework for measuring the performance of a business beyond traditional measures like profits. Instead, the triple bottom line looks at environmental and social factors. So, rather than a business having one “bottom line,” the triple bottom line approach posits that there are three ...
